## Local Setup — TumbleKey Locker Flow

To run the laundry-locker access flow locally, start the mock locker daemon first (`make lockers`), then the API. The unlock handshake needs seeded resident records or every scan returns "no-match" — run the seed script once. The seeder and the API both read the residents database via the connection below:

primary connection of yagep-kahip = redis://giliel_svc:zYiKsLL2PLpfPL@db-348f.xolmarsys.corp:5432/fenwyn

### Step 9 — Export Service Key Unseal

New contractors: the Ledgerfall spreadsheet export service is memory-sensitive, so this step must be done with the export queue drained. Confirm resident memory on the Norwick export nodes is under 40% before proceeding—unsealing during a large export can trigger OOM kills and corrupt the ceremony log. Record the heap reading in the ledger, obtain a countersignature, and then unseal the export signing key with the recovery passphrase below.

unlock words, kagef-taduf: fenir-quenix-norwyn-sorvan-gormir-gorir-fraok

## Cold Starts in the Dispatch Handlers

The Marrowgate dispatch functions scale to zero after ten minutes of inactivity, so the first request following a release typically takes two to four seconds. The warmup job pings each handler after deployment, but it only covers the default region. As release manager, confirm the warmup completed before announcing the release, and check the latency table for spikes. That table sits in the telemetry database, which you can reach with the connection string below.

warehouse DSN: mssql://rusdor_svc:0FSWCn9@db-951a.paliqforge.local:5432/ulawyn